Section Ins 5.33 - Prehearing conference
(1) PURPOSES. One or more prehearing conferences may be held to consider or determine any of the following:
(a) Possibilities for settling the case.
(b) The clarification of issues.
(c) The necessity or desirability of amending the pleadings.
(d) The possibility of obtaining stipulations of fact, law or evidence that will avoid unnecessary arguments or offers of proof.
(e) The party having the burden of proof in the proceeding.
(f) The identification of witnesses and evidence for hearing.
(g) Limitations on the number of witnesses.
(h) The deadline for prefiling exhibits and prepared testimony under s. Ins 5.39(5) (e).
(i) Prehearing motions and discovery requests.
(j) The need for an interpreter under s. 885.37(3) (b), Stats.
(k) The scheduling of proceedings in the contested case, including the date, time and location of additional prehearing conferences, motion hearings and the hearing.
(L) The scheduling of any telephonic testimony that will be offered.
(m) Other matters which may aid the orderly consideration and disposition of the contested case.
(2) MEMORANDUM. At the conclusion of a prehearing conference, the administrative law judge shall prepare a memorandum for the record under s. 227.44(4) (b), Stats., which summarizes the action taken and the agreements reached at the conference. Agreements reached are binding on the parties throughout the proceeding, except as otherwise ordered by the administrative law judge. The administrative law judge may, in conjunction with the memorandum, issue any procedural orders necessary to implement the actions taken at the prehearing conference. Copies of the memorandum shall be served on all parties.
(3) SUBMISSION ON BRIEFS. If the parties agree, during or after a prehearing conference, that there is no dispute of material fact, the matter may be submitted to the administrative law judge on written stipulated facts and briefs, as provided in s. Ins 5.41.
